Spurs extend win record after defeating Monaco 4-1

rik Lamela of Spurs celebrates after scoring his team's second goal during the UEFA Europa League Group J match between Tottenham Hotspur and AS Monaco at White Hart Lane on December 10, 2015 in London, United Kingdom.

Erik Lamela ensured Tottenham’s victory over Monaco by scoring the team’s first hat-trick in the first half. Tottenham are entering the knock out stage of the Europa League as group winners after thrashing Monaco 4-1. Despite starting without the likes of Harry Kane, Dele Alli and Christian Eriksen, the Spurs were able to extend their run of form to nine games unbeaten. Mauricio Pochettino’s side suffered only two defeats in their last 21 matches.
